Mathnasium's popularity stems from its unique approach to math education, which focuses on building a strong foundation and confidence in math skills. As students face increasingly complex math challenges in school, parents are looking for programs that can provide a safety net and help them stay ahead of the curve. Mathnasium's success has led to its expansion across the US, with over 1,000 centers serving students from kindergarten to high school.

Mathnasium is a supplemental education program that offers individualized math lessons to students of all ages and skill levels. Here's a simplified overview of how it works:
